About meth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ate
meth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ate (PubChem CID 54742951) has the molecular formula C8H9NO6
and a molecular weight of 215.16 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ate is COC(=O)c1[nH]c(OC(C)=O)c(O)c1O.
What is the InChIKey of meth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ate?
The InChIKey is DJQNITVOCOTWNI-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C8H9NO6/c1-3(10)15-7-6(12)5(11)4(9-7)8(13)14-2/h9,11-12H,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ate?
methyl 5-acetyloxy-3,4-dihydroxy-1H-pyrrole-2-carboxylate has a molecular weight of 215.16 g/mol, XLogP of 0.14, 2 rotatable bonds, 3 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
